Appsecure logo

CVE-2024-9001: Medium Vulnerability in TOTOLINK T10 Firmware

A medium-severity vulnerability has been identified in the TOTOLINK T10 firmware, which could allow for OS command injection. Organizations are advised to take appropriate action.

MEDIUMCVSS 5.3 · Published September 19, 2024

Not a customer? See how AppSecure simulates real world attacks to protect your infrastructure.

Speak to Experts

A vulnerability was found in TOTOLINK T10 4.1.8cu.5207. This vulnerability allows for OS command injection through the function setTracerouteCfg in the file /cgi-bin/cstecgi.cgi. The manipulation of the argument command leads to remote exploitation. With a CVSS score of 5.3, this vulnerability is classified as medium severity, and it is crucial for organizations using affected systems to prioritize remediation.

Risk to organizations includes potential unauthorized access to sensitive information and disruption of service. While there is no confirmed public exploit available, the vulnerability has been disclosed, indicating that it may be exploited in the wild. Organizations should address this vulnerability in their priority patch cycle.

Given the nature of the vulnerability, organizations are advised to monitor for any signs of exploitation and apply necessary patches as they become available. It is important to stay informed about further developments regarding this vulnerability.

The vendor has been contacted regarding this vulnerability but has not responded. Therefore, it is imperative for users to take proactive measures to secure their devices.

Vulnerability Details

The official CVE description states that this vulnerability affects the function setTracerouteCfg of the file /cgi-bin/cstecgi.cgi in the TOTOLINK T10 firmware version 4.1.8cu.5207. The vulnerability is classified under CWE-78, indicating a command injection issue.

The publication date for this vulnerability is September 19, 2024. Organizations should be aware of this vulnerability type and assess their exposure.

Technical Analysis

The root cause of this vulnerability lies in the inadequate input validation on the command argument within the setTracerouteCfg function. Attackers may exploit this vulnerability remotely, as the attack vector is classified as NETWORK.

The attack complexity is considered LOW, meaning that attackers do not require significant resources or specialized knowledge to exploit the vulnerability. Privileges required are LOW, which further increases the risk. User interaction is not required, allowing attackers to exploit the vulnerability without any need for user intervention.

Regarding the impact, the confidentiality, integrity, and availability impacts are all classified as LOW, indicating that while significant harm may not occur, there is still a risk of unauthorized command execution on the device.

Risk & Impact Analysis

Real-world deployment risk is present due to the potential for unauthorized access and control over the affected devices. The blast radius could extend to any organizations utilizing the vulnerable firmware version. This vulnerability may lead to further attacks if exploited, including data breaches or service disruptions.

Organizations should assess their risk based on the CVSS score of 5.3, which suggests medium urgency for remediation. The lack of a known exploit does not diminish the importance of applying necessary patches.

Signal

Status

Known Exploit

No

Public PoC

No

Actively Exploited

No

Ransomware Use

No

Affected Versions

The affected product is the TOTOLINK T10 firmware version 4.1.8cu.5207. Organizations running this firmware should take immediate action to mitigate the risk.

Mitigation & Remediation

Organizations should prioritize patching the TOTOLINK T10 firmware to the latest version as soon as it is released. In the absence of a patch, consider implementing network controls to limit access to the vulnerable function.

For further information on security practices, organizations can refer to the penetration testing services that can help identify vulnerabilities within their infrastructure.

Detection Guidance

Organizations should monitor logs for unusual activity related to the setTracerouteCfg function. Additionally, behavioral anomalies indicating unauthorized command execution should be investigated.

AppSecure Threat Intelligence Insight

The long-term significance of CVE-2024-9001 highlights the need for robust input validation in firmware development. This vulnerability represents a trend where inadequate security measures lead to exploitable weaknesses.

Security teams should analyze their current security posture and take proactive measures to prevent similar vulnerabilities in the future, ensuring comprehensive security assessments are part of the development lifecycle.

For further reading on vulnerability management, organizations can explore the vulnerability management program and its impact on reducing risk.

Additionally, the importance of continuous security testing can be emphasized through resources like the penetration testing methodology to ensure all aspects of security are covered.

Finally, organizations should keep abreast of industry trends related to vulnerabilities and threats to better prepare for future risks.

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

Latest CVEs. Recently published vulnerabilities from the NVD database.

View all vulnerabilities
CVE IDSeverity
CVE-2025-65418HIGH
CVE-2025-65417MEDIUM
CVE-2025-65416MEDIUM
CVE-2025-65415MEDIUM
CVE-2025-61314HIGH

Protect Your Business with Hacker-Focused Approach.